Abstract

The present invention relates to an environmental protection type PVC plastisol, wherein the plastisol composition adopts an environmental protection type non-o-benzene plasticizer and an environmental protection heat stabilizer, such that various performances of the coating are ensured while environmental protection performance of the plastisol material is ensured. Components of the plastisol comprise a PVC paste resin, a non-o-benzene environmental protection plasticizer, an environmental protection heat stabilizer, nano active calcium carbonate, tween 80, an adhesion reinforcing agent, hydrogenated castor oil and carbon black. The plastisol material is coated on tinplate, wherein the thickness is 0.5 mm; and baking is performed for 40 minutes at a temperature of 120 DEG C, wherein the coating does not occur yellowing, the impact property is good (a QCT-I paint film impactor is adopted, and the optimal result is more than 100 cm.kg), the flexibility is good (a QTX paint film flexibility tester is adopted, and the optimal result is 0.5 mm), and the adhesion test is cohesive failure. The prepared plastisol of the present invention is mainly used for seam welding sealing glue of automobile, stone-hitting resisting coating of chassis, and other fields.

Background technology
Antirust, the sealing property of automobile is directly connected to the comfortableness of automobile, attractive in appearance and integeral vehicle life.If the automobile rust preventing is improper, vehicle body will occur corrosion at short notice pernicious damage phenomenons such as perforation take place even.At present, painting dressing automobiles is still the antirust main means of automobile, but owing at some privileged sites such as weld seam, because point effect makes steel plate port position paint film thinner, does not have required rust-proof effect.In addition, because the existence of weld seam causes rainwater, dust etc. to invade the car chamber interior easily and pollute indoor environment, so we needs the weld seam sealer of a kind of rust protection, good seal performance.Pvc plastisol is as the best a kind of sizing material of the most frequently used over-all properties of present stage, and it is widespread use in the weld seam sealer not only, at the bottom of car, wheel cover and splash pan etc. locate and can also use as stone-impact-proof paint.
In decades recently; The PVC goods are people's bone of contentions to the pollution problem of environment always, and the maximum shortcoming of polyvinyl chloride resin is a thermostability, and structure is unstable relatively to heat, light; Take off the HCl reaction easily, therefore in the course of processing, need to add a large amount of auxiliary agents and overcome.Portioned product is that more serious destruction is arranged to environment in the at present used PVC auxiliary agent, and the problem of pvc plastisol aspect environment protection also attracts many disputes thus, and dispute point wherein also mainly concentrates on the processing aid aspect.Though because polyvinyl chloride resin itself in process of production can be in resin residual a part of carcinogens vinyl chloride monomer, along with the continuous progress of polyvinyl chloride resin production technology, the vinylchlorid residue problem is well controlled.Therefore its environmental issue has just mainly focused on this one side of auxiliary agent, and wherein topmost problem concentrates on softening agent and stablizer two broad aspect.
At present, to discovery after its further investigation, DOP especially has a large amount of remnants in lung at human body to the pvc plastisol primary plasticizer DOP (DOP) of domestic main flow through relevant researchist.U.S. authoritative institution has carried out biological assay to the DOP carinogenicity, and the result finds that DOP has very strong carinogenicity to animal livers.DOP just became one of 18 types of chemicalses of European Union's forbidding before many years in addition.Everything shows that all the caused problem of environmental pollution of DOP has caused the enough attention of people to it.Contain C 6~C 20The pyrrolidone of straight chained alkyl, side chain alkyl and cyclic alkyl can be as the softening agent of PVC, wherein C 8And C 12Pyrrolidone the most common.Alkyl pyrrolidone is its environment friendly as the sharpest edges of PVC softening agent.The alkyl group that has certain-length in addition in the alkyl pyrrolidone exists, so it has good consistency to polyvinyl chloride resin itself.Simultaneously, there are some researches show that the plasticising effect of alkyl pyrrolidone in screening formulation is better than DINP.The one two propyl alcohol dibenzoates that contract have good consistency as a kind of monomer-plasticizer and various kinds of resin; It also has many distinguishing features such as consistency, static resistance, resistance to crocking, anti-volatility and nontoxicity when possessing the general character of general softening agent, and also there is outstanding behaviours aspects such as the tensile strength of goods, resistance to tearing and glossiness.
Stablizer is as another large focal spot of environmental issue concern in the pvc plastisol, and is same because had heavy metal elements such as a large amount of lead, cadmium in the in the past used main flow stablizer, and makes the exploitation of novel non-toxic heat stabilizer and use suddenly wait to advocate.In recent years, China progressively payes attention to the toxicity problem of PVC thermo-stabilizer, and low toxicity, nontoxic PVC thermo-stabilizer have become Development Trend.Universally acknowledged PVC low toxicity thermo-stabilizer is mainly organic tin; But the toxicity problem to the organic tin thermo-stabilizer has had new understanding in recent years; In heat is that organic tin volatilizees fast, emits toxic substance, can produce very strong injury to operator's immunity system.Calcium/zinc composite heat stabilizer is to have one of kind of development prospect in the non-toxic stabilizer most, has characteristics such as cheap, nontoxic, efficient, can effectively replace the imported product of expensive, reduces product cost.The hydrotalcite thermo-stabilizer is a kind of novel inorganic PVC auxiliary heat stabilizer of the eighties in last century exploitation, can with the collaborative thermostability that improves of thermo-stabilizer such as zinc soap.Its thermostable effect is better than barium soap, calcium soap and their mixture.The hydrotalcite thermo-stabilizer also has the advantage of good insulating, good, the good weatherability of the transparency and good processability in addition, does not receive sulphide staining, is a kind of nontoxic auxiliary heat stabilizer.
Summary of the invention
The object of the present invention is to provide a kind of environment-friendly type PVC plastisol.This pvc plastisol is on the basis of traditional plastisol component, to have selected environment-friendly type softening agent and environment-friendly type thermo-stabilizer for use.Guaranteeing under the situation that the original performance of sizing material does not run off, effectively must improve its environment friendly.
Above-mentioned purpose realizes with environmentally friendly pvc plastisol compsn of the present invention.This pvc plastisol compsn comprises that the PVC of 100-500 mass parts sticks with paste resin, the non-adjacent benzene class environment-friendly plasticizer of 200-500 mass parts, the environmental protection thermo-stabilizer of 10-50 mass parts, the nm-class active calcium carbonate of 200-400 mass parts, the tween 80 of 0-100 mass parts, the adhesion enhancer of 0-50 mass parts, the THIXCIN of 0-50 mass parts and the carbon black of 0-50 mass parts.
The concrete preparation method of plastisol composition is: PVC is stuck with paste resin, thermo-stabilizer, tween 80, THIXCIN, adhesion enhancer and carbon black join first being uniformly dispersed in the plasticiser system; Then load weighted nm-class active calcium carbonate is joined in this system in batches; Controlling certain rate of dispersion makes system remain on continuation high speed dispersion 3h under 50 ℃ of left and right sides temperature conditionss; At last scattered sizing material is moved on to deaeration 5h in the vacuum unit, discharging.On tinplate tin, evenly be coated with the sizing material of one deck 0.5mm, toast 40min down at 120 ℃, a series of physical and chemical performances of test coating.
Compared with prior art, the inventive method has the following advantages:
1, this method is selected the environment-friendly type plasticiser system for use, has improved the environmental-protecting performance of sizing material and coating;
2, this method is selected for use and is possessed synergistic environment-friendly type composite thermal stabilizer system, on the basis of common environmental protection thermo-stabilizer, further improves the thermal stability and the feature of environmental protection.
The practical implementation method
Embodiment 1
350gPVC is stuck with paste resin, 1: 1 nano hydrotalcite class of 15g mass ratio and calcium/zinc complex class composite thermal stabilizer, 65g tween 80,20g THIXCIN, 3: 2 blocked polyurethane prepolymer of 30g mass ratio and the compound adhesion enhancer of dimer acid type Versamid and 30g carbon black, and to join mass ratio be that 2: 1 alkyl pyrrolidones and contract and are uniformly dispersed in the composite elasticizer of two propyl alcohol dibenzoates; The 400g nm-class active calcium carbonate joins this system in batches then; Control certain rate of dispersion and make system high speed dispersion 2h under the situation of 50 ℃ of maintenances; Vacuum defoamation 5h then, discharging.
The above-mentioned black paste pvc plastisol that makes stored after half a year, and viscosity increases little (initial viscosity 38Pas/25 ℃, viscosity is 57Pas/25 ℃ after half a year), and it is constant to re-use performance.This plastisol is uniformly coated on the tinplate tin iron plate, and 0.5mm is thick.After 120 ℃ of curing 40min, coating is xanthochromia slightly, and impact property is good, and (the QCT-I paint film impactor, 100cmkg), the tack test result is a cohesive failure.
